PET Trends – Indian Markets
Current Practises
❖PET : Single highest growing Rigid Package
❖Globally @ 4-5 % & Asia @ 6-8 % CAGR
❖Indian PET markets @ 8-12 % CAGR
❖Beverages, Water, EO, Milk, Healthcare, Personal Care,..
❖PET consumption in India is now 1.0 million tonne plus.
Emerging Trends : PET
❖Edible Oil, Dairy Products, MW, Bulk Water, Spices,...
❖Fresh Juices, Personal Care, Health Care, Niche Drinks
❖CANS, BCT, APET/CPET, Injection Moulded items..
❖FMCG Industry: Small-Big Packs and PCR Intiatives
❖Enhanced focus on Recycling and Sustainability!
PET - Expanding in New Application areas in India!

PET : Ergonomic Factors
PET PVC PP HDPE LDPE
Oxygen 30 60-100 750 750 3000
Carbon-dioxide 100 150-230 3000 3000 15000
Water vapour 4 4 0.5 0.5 1.3
O2 and CO2 : cm3 . cm/cm2 . sec . cm Hg x 103 at 23°C and 50% RH
H2O : g . cm/cm2 . sec / cm Hg at 37°C and 95% RH
Source : Akzo Plastics
16
• Oxygen is the most critical factor affecting stability of oil.
• PET has the lowest OTR, hence safeguards the oil quality effectively
• PET offers best shelf-life among all other polymers
** Shelf-life in PET can be further enhanced with help of Nitrogen-dosing
Excellent Barrier Properties

PET Innovations : Fresh & Flavoured Milk
Current Practises
❖India: Largest producer of milk in world.
❖Fresh Milk : Pouch, HDPE & PET bottle
❖Flavoured Milk: Tetrapack, Glass, PP, PET.
❖UHT Milk : Tetrapack, Pouch, HDPE & PET
Emerging Trends
❖PET: Fresh/Flavoured/UHT Milk, Butter Milk..
❖Fresh Milk - Gowardhan Dairy
❖1 L, 28 g, Transparent PET, Shelf Life: 7 d,
❖Flavoured Milk – Amul:
❖Launched 200 ml: May’13 & started 2 new lines
❖UHT Milk: Opaque White PET Bottle for Amul, 200 ml
PET : Creating a New space for Milk Branding !

Barrier PET : Small CSD Bottles in India
25
Problem Solution Advantages Opportunity
• Faster Loss of Fizz
• 6 Weeks Shelf Life
• Silica Coated Bottle
• > 20 weeks shelf life
• Penetration into more geographical areas
• Elimination of product returns
• Retailer and Customer Delight
• Increased Sales
• Sugar Intake Control
• Affordable to masses
• Packaging of Hygroscopic powders!
Barrier PET : Game Changer!

• Manufacturing range : 200-1200 kg/hWidth range : 0.5-1.2 mThickness range : 0.20 - 1.20 mm Transparent/Coloured/Opaque
• Applications range:Thin Sheet (0.18 to 1.20 mm)
Printing, FFS, Blister(0.15-0.40 mm)Thermoforming (0.30-0.80 mm)
Cartons/Trays (0.40-0.60 mm)
Blister Packs (0.15-0.40 mm)
Window packs (0.15-0.20 mm)
• Factors for Growing Interest in APET:
Food-contact SafetyPharma-Contact Safety Crystal clear Clarity Environment FriendlinessPrice-Competitiveness
• Substitutes PVC, PP, PS & PC sheets
APET Sheet Range : IndiaAPET Sheet
Blister packing for tablets in APET on Precision Gears (PG) machine. Adhesion with aluminum/glassein paper satisfactory. No package - size variation.APET could be thermoformed @ 15 °C lower than PVC.Burr formation at edges: Modified existing ‘Cutting tools’. Shrinkage of APET similar to PVC (~ 0.20%).
Possible to down-gauge w.r.t. PVC, viz from 250 to 200 m. Stability tests concluded APET to be better than PVC sheet.Transport worthiness was established.
End-User decided to use APET sheet.PG modified cutting tool/heating plate.Modifications done for one of their linesCommercial introduction in 2 plants done.
Total savings for 2 plants @ 100% conversion was ~ Rs 40 lakh/year.Used APET for a limited period (limited nos. of sheet suppliers in 2000). Usage in Pharma linked to ‘Flat bed heating & addressing sheet cutting’.
APET (‘ABA’) is promoted as PVC replacement (primarily Calendered sheet). Due to lower specific gravity and down-gauging, APET is ‘Cost-competitive’.
APET Case-Study – Pharma MajorAPET Case-Study – Pharma Major

Recycled PET – Indian Market
◼ Recyclability influences ‘Pack, CSR, Sustainability, Brand image & Loyalty’
◼ PET bottle consumption= 1.0 MMT & Collection=0.9 MMT bottles (@ 90 %)
◼ RIL uses 45 KTA + of Recycled PET : Largest PET bottle collector in India
◼ 150 nos plus Collection-cum-Baling Centers in India networked with RIL
◼ RIL: 10 KTA B2B Recycling Plant : ‘Relpet Green’ : RG 80 and RG 84
RIL works with Brand-owners to support Recycling Projects
Bailing Sorting Crushing Washing
Elutriation Drying Sorting Packing

Innovative Solutions – Waste Plastic to Roads
➢Leverage binding properties of plastics
• Minimize moisture absorption
• Improves impact, abrasion
➢Current Indian Bitumen demand is ~ 6
MMTPA.
➢10% of usage of Plastic waste can
consume 550 to 600 KTA of plastic waste
Increases life of road, creates a win-win situation
